The Evolution of Bonuses in Online Casinos
In the early 2000s, online casino bonuses were primarily straightforward, often consisting of matched deposits or free spins. However, as the industry matured, so did the sophistication of these incentives. Today, players expect personalized offers, loyalty rewards, and enticing match bonuses that provide real value. According to recent data from industry analysts, bonus offers account for approximately 65% of new player acquisition metrics and significantly influence deposit behavior.
| Bonus Type | Typical Value |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Welcome/Match Bonus | 100% up to $200 | Most popular for new users; common in Canadian markets |
| Free Spins | 10-50 spins | Usually tied to specific slot titles |
| Loyalty Rewards | Points-based tiers | Encourages ongoing engagement |
